Player of the Year nominations
LONDON, April 11: Cristiano Ronaldo has the chance to retain his English PFA Players’ Player of the Year award after being named one of the six nominations for this season’s prize on Friday
Ronaldo’s dazzling form for Manchester United has taken Sir Alex Ferguson’s side to the top of the Premier League and into the Champions League semi-finals.
The Portugal winger won the prestigious award, voted for by his fellow players, in 2007 and has been nominated alongside Arsenal duo Cesc Fabregas and Emmanuel Adebayor, Liverpool pair Steven Gerrard and Fernando Torres and Portsmouth goalkeeper David James.—AFP
